Hwy 26 Now Open Through West Point Area!  Repair Costs Estimated At $3.5 Million

West Point, CA…The California Department of Transportation (Caltrans) will open eastbound and westbound State Route 26 (SR-26) from Higdon Road to the North Fork Mokelumne River Bridge, just west of West Point, following a 69-day full closure due to storm related damage. State Route 26 opened on Wednesday, April 19, 2017 at 4:00 p.m. Final […]

Hwy 26 Scheduled To Reopen At Higdon Road Closure On April 21st!

Calaveras County – The California Department of Transportation (Caltrans) has closed eastbound and westbound State Route 26 (SR-26) from Higdon Road to the North Fork Mokelumne River Bridge, just west of West Point, for road repairs due to storm damage. The full highway closure will continue as repairs are being made with an estimated date […]

Hwy 26 Damaged & Closed At Higdon Road In West Point.  Detour Through Mokelumne Hill

West Point, CA…CHP is reporting that Hwy 26 is closed at Higdon Road in West Point. Caltrans is estimating the roadway to be closed for an extended period, several days or more, the entire roadway has washed away. SR-26 is closed from the Amador/Calaveras County Line and Higdon Rd in West Point. The only detour […]

Numbers Without Power Continue To Climb

Arnold, CA…The numbers of customers without power continues to rise instead of fall as crews work hard to stay ahead of the wave of trees dropping into the power lines. PG&E’s earlier estimates on getting power restored have come and gone. The sobering numbers are as follows…Arnold, 42 Outages affecting 4718 Customers. Avery, 1 Outages […]
